This is a simple heading indicator that works in two modes - normal and target mode. (It only works for plane configuration)
Normal Mode
It just shows your current heading, if you want to know the heading in degrees just multiply the value by 10 (for example 25 is 250 degrees)
Target Mode
This mode will help you get to your target, just select the desired target, click on the "TRG Mode" label and try to match the lilac square with the white triangle on top, then your course will be directed to the target.
This is a simple installation made for demonstration purposes (can be rotated - yaw input + use the camera - throttle axis for camera zoom); if you like, you can of course use this in your creations.
Don't forget, use the tinker panel to scale; it doesn't work for rockets (only planes)!
